Gold Hits All-Time High, Futures Climb Above Rs. 50,000 For First Time

Domestic gold and silver futures soared to all-time highs on Wednesday tracking a global rally, with the yellow metal contract climbing above the Rs 50,000 mark for the first time ever. Multi Commodity Exchange (MCX) gold futures - due for delivery on August 5 - rose by Rs 493 or 1 per cent to a record Rs 50,020 in morning. Silver futures due for a September 4 delivery climbed to a record Rs 60,782, surging 6 per cent from their previous close of Rs 57,342. Sky-high prices have already dampened retail demand for gold in India, the world's second largest consumer of the precious metal.
